Name the following compound:CH3-O-CH2-CH2-CH3Group of answer choicesPropyl methyl etherMethyl propanolEtherMethyl propyl ether
Solution
The compound CH3-O-CH2-CH2-CH3 is named as Methyl propyl ether.
Here's the step by step process:
-
Identify the main functional group: The main functional group in this compound is an ether (-O-).
-
Identify the alkyl groups attached to the oxygen: On one side of the oxygen, there is a methyl group (CH3-). On the other side, there is a propyl group (CH2-CH2-CH3).
-
Name the compound: In ethers, the alkyl groups are named in alphabetical order followed by 'ether'. Therefore, the name of this compound is Methyl propyl ether.
